Study On Correlation Between HLA Class Ⅱ Gene Allele And Gestational Diabetes Mellitus

Objective: Through the comparative study of part HLA classⅡgene in Shanxi region between the gestational diabetes mellitus(GDM) and normal pregnancy group,we found the susceptibility genes and protective genes of GDM in Shanxi region. And to suggest the susceptible group prevent and intervent earlier, avoiding the occurrence of GDM and the type 2 diabetes.Methods: 39 cases of GDM and 42 cases of normal pregnant women were enrolled in this study,who were excluded diseases correlated with HLA gene in the first hospital of shanxi medical university from 2006.3 through 2007.3. 81 blood samples were collected in vacutainer tubes with EDTA from pregnant women, 39 with GDM and 42 without GDM .Then the samples were frozen .in -70℃refrigerator; Saturated phenol - chloroform extraction method of genomic DNA was used; Part sequence of HLA-II gene was examined by polymerase chain reaction sequence specific primer(PCR-SSP). Based on the actual laboratory work and requirements of statistical analysis , 30 cases in GDM group and 30 cases in control group sent to sequencing. Statistical analysis was performed using SPSS statistical software, the groups were compared usingχ2 test , the results were considered significant at P<0.05.Results:(1)Significant differences were noted between the two groups in HLA-II gene frequency in Shanxi region,which were consistent with previous reports; (2)It was observed that gene frequency of HLA-DRB1*0301,DQB1*0201 was increased in GDM group compared with the control group (38.5%vs16.7%;28.2%vs9.5%), there was significant difference between two group. (P﹤0.05). (3)We also observed a decrease in HLA-DQA1*0103 was seen in GDM(7.7%vs14.3%),there was also significant difference between them. (P﹤0.05). (4) The gene frequency of HLA- DQA1*0501 was increased in GDM group compared with control group, but the statistical difference was not significant(P﹥0.05).Conclusion:HLA-DRB1*0301 and DQB1*0201 gene are the susceptible genes of GDM in Shanxi region. HLA-DRA1*0103 may be the protective genes of GDM in this area.
